VD BLUES unknown, perhaps fall 1961
While no live performances of this song have been recorded or reported, Dylan played it for Tony Glover's Minnesota Hotel Tape recording. It appears likely that the song, part of the "infamous medley," turned up in Dylan's early New York club performances.

VINCENT VAN GOGH April 18, 1976 Civic Center Arena (Lakeland)
Performed only as a duet with Bobby Neuwirth, during the 1976 Rolling Thunder tour. By Heylin's reckoning, the previous day's semi-public dress rehearsal in Clearwater would be the first live performance.
